Wendover Sparrowhawks – October 2021

The netball season is back! After what has been a challenging 18 months for everyone at Sparrowhawks headquarters, we are delighted to be returning to the Aylesbury League for competitive netball this autumn. As a Club, we endeavoured to maintain contact with players throughout the pandemic, be it through online fitness sessions or outdoor modified training, using England Netball modifications. The Club was able to organise the ever-popular Wendover Netball Summer League this year for the third time which, as always, was well received and supported by other local clubs. Despite the challenges faced in the last year or so, we are so excited to have a continually expanding Club, with two established teams entered in the Senior League and a third team in formation. Our Youth Netball Club is also flourishing, with three teams entered into the Youth League this autumn too. We would like to thank the Lionel Abel Smith Trust for their support this year, providing us with a grant which enabled a return to training when we were able, as our usual fundraising events could not take place.
